**Postmortem timeline — Marrowgrid report builder**

14:02 — Plugin authors report grouped rows reordering after the sort refactor shipped. 14:20 — Confirmed the new comparator is unstable for equal keys, breaking any plugin relying on insertion order. 14:45 — Rollback initiated. 15:10 — Stable comparator restored; plugins using tie-break hooks unaffected. Action: stability is now a documented contract. Affected build token follows.

pipeline stamp: htk6_35e0c9

**Mgmt Meeting Minutes — Retiring the Brightline Range**

Quick recap for sales leads at Fenholt Supplies: we agreed to retire the Brightline fixture range by year-end. Remaining stock moves to clearance pricing next month, and accounts on standing orders get migrated to the Lumetta range. Trade-in incentives were approved in principle. The confidential note on next steps sits just below.

board note of bajof-bajeg: The pricing group signed off on a budget of $13.4 million for Project Sildor. The renewal with Lamixek Holdings closes at $48.9 million a year, 49 percent above the last contract.

## Deployment

Shipping PingPilot, our deploy-status chat bot, is pretty painless. Build the container, push it to the internal registry, and let the Orbwick pipeline roll it out — no manual steps. The bot joins the release room on boot and starts narrating pipeline events within a minute. Reviewer heads-up: watch the polling interval, it's easy to get wrong. It boots with these config values.

service settings:
PRAIX_LOG_LEVEL=error
PRAIX_METRICS_HOST=metrics.praix.qorvelcorp.corp
PRAIX_POOL_SIZE=16

### Reviewing docs changes: the Quillmark linter

Every pull request that touches files under `docs/` runs Quillmark, our documentation linter, in CI. It enforces heading hierarchy, checks that code samples compile against the Harborline SDK, and flags terminology that drifts from the approved glossary. As a reviewer, please do not approve a change with Quillmark warnings suppressed unless the author has linked a waiver. The rule catalog, waiver process, and local setup instructions are documented on the following internal page.

wiki page, bagaf-fawip: https://harbor.tolvaqsys.local/pages/repo/pages/secrets/eac969ffc71f356b